Elite Fields for World Cross Country Trials have been released ahead of the event to be held 28th November at Stromlo Forest Park, Canberra. Entry Lists

 

Alex Stitt takes out the South Australia 5000m State Championships in 13:58.26 ahead of Adrian Potter and Jacob Cocks. Kate Holland-Smith won the State Title in 16:44.52 ahead of Tiana Cetta and Emily Wass. Official Results

 

Tess Kirsop Cole won the Vic Milers 3000m in 9 Seth O’Donnell wins in a meet record of 7:55, after winning the B race earlier. Lucas Chis came second in the A race in 8:00.26, just ahead of Will Lewis in 8:00.73. Tess Kirsop-Cole won the A race in 9:33.80 ahead of Katherine Dowie in 9:35.41 and Sophie Hall in 9:45.96 .

Sam Clifford won the Point To Pinnacle in a course record, ascending to the top of kunyani from Sandy Point in 1:21:29 ahead of James Hansen and Leo Peterson. Danette Sheehan won in 1:41:25 ahead of Alice McGushin and Madeline Murray. Official Results

 

Josh Phillips ran 14:07 and Aynsley Van Graan ran 16:37 to post the fastest times of the day at the Gong 5000 on the Illawarra Criterium Track. Official Results
